Output 34f2e0acf2b094d5d81230aea6008313eb98e78205e641d3f928c093b7624267:18

value
23224971
script pubkey
OP_0 OP_PUSHBYTES_20 5e2e26623edf87040ab0685ce9b3f3340845c033
address
bc1qtchzvc37m7rsgz4sdpwwnvlnxsyytspneguq4c
transaction
34f2e0acf2b094d5d81230aea6008313eb98e78205e641d3f928c093b7624267
spent
true